Choosing the Right Soccer Shoes for Coed Leagues with Flat Feet Support

Finding the right soccer shoes is crucial for performance and comfort, especially if you have flat feet. Coed leagues often involve varied playing surfaces and a range of player skill levels, so versatility and support are key. Here’s a breakdown of what to consider when choosing a pair:

Ankle Support: Preventing Injuries

For players with flat feet, ankle stability is paramount. Flat feet can lead to overpronation (inward rolling of the foot), increasing the risk of ankle sprains. High-top cleats (like those offered by DREAM PAIRS and Biayvisas) provide superior ankle support compared to low-cut options. The extended collar wraps around the ankle, limiting excessive movement. Consider how much ankle freedom you need – some high-tops can feel restrictive, so try different levels of support. More support equals more protection, but potentially less agility.

Arch Support & Insole Comfort

This is the most critical factor for flat feet. Many standard soccer cleats offer minimal arch support. Look for shoes specifically mentioning support for flat feet (like the Biayvisas boots), or plan to replace the insole with a supportive orthotic. A good insole will help distribute pressure evenly across your foot, reducing strain and fatigue. Cushioned insoles (found in DREAM PAIRS) are beneficial for comfort, but prioritize arch support first. A comfortable shoe won’t matter if it doesn’t address the biomechanical issues caused by flat feet.

Outsole & Surface Versatility

Coed leagues often mean playing on a variety of surfaces – natural grass, artificial turf, and sometimes hard ground. Multi-ground (MG) outsoles (like those in the Adidas Goletto IX) are designed to handle this variability. They feature a combination of stud shapes and patterns to provide traction on different surfaces. If you primarily play on one surface, you can optimize for that (e.g., firm ground cleats for natural grass), but MG outsoles offer the most flexibility. Consider the stud length – shorter studs are better for softer surfaces, while longer studs provide more grip on hard ground.

Upper Material & Fit

The upper material impacts comfort, ball control, and breathability. Synthetic leather (found in many models) is durable, lightweight, and offers good ball feel. Mesh uppers (LSIDORYC) enhance breathability, keeping your feet cool and dry. A snug, secure fit is essential. Adjustable laces are standard, but ensure the shoe doesn’t pinch or rub anywhere. Some shoes (like MIGPOGZAI) mention a textured upper for enhanced ball control – a nice bonus for improving your game.

Weight & Agility

While support is key, you don’t want cleats that feel clunky. Lightweight materials (highlighted in LSIDORYC and MIGPOGZAI) allow for quicker movements and faster reactions. A lighter shoe requires less energy to move, reducing fatigue during long games. However, extremely lightweight shoes may sacrifice some durability or support.
